We've got coal, lots of it. An example; in the NW of the country is a 4GW thermal power station. It's a monster.
P7250097.JPG


We are building an even bigger power station, 4.8GW, next to it. The local coal mine has reserves to power these two stations, which together will produce about 20-25% of the country's energy needs, for over 90 years. This one coal mine has estimated reserves of 2,800 Million tons.
 
I Googled the Eskom website; without the small gas & oil fired emergency stations, the installed generating capacity is 40.2GW. It's the 'missing' 5 or 6 gigawatts that's giving us the problem....:cry:
